Output 5deaba280f682c3a27745e2aaae37cc9f18c3e1ef57a9dffbb569ca622c7a4e2:35

value
372312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bdf70f1645e2e399797267526cf96108a03a6ed OP_EQUAL
address
3Cyzi71k3QqfqvUs44EoGFTB3wEFzwmSxT
transaction
5deaba280f682c3a27745e2aaae37cc9f18c3e1ef57a9dffbb569ca622c7a4e2
confirmations
275957
spent
true